In chemistry, a solution is a homogeneous mixture composed of only one phase. in such a mixture, a solute is a substance dissolved in another substance, known as a solvent. The answer to a problem or the explanation for something. the solution to the mystery. [uncountable] the process by which a gas, liquid, or solid is spread in a gas, liquid, or solid without chemical change: in solution. [countable] a mixture of substances by this process. Solution, in chemistry, a homogenous mixture of two or more substances in relative amounts that can be varied continuously up to what is called the limit of solubility. the term solution is commonly applied to the liquid state of matter, but solutions of gases and solids are possible.
